Abstract: In this paper, we develop some foundations for a theory of algebraic geometry of congruences on commutative semirings. By studying the structure of congruences, firstly, we show that the spectrum consisting of prime congruences on a semirings has a Zariski topological structure; Then, for two semirings we consider the polynomial semiring and the affine space For any congruence on and congruence on we introduce the algebraic varieties in which are the set of zeros in of the system of polynomial congruence equations given by When is a prime congruence, we find these varieties satisfying the axiom of closed sets, and forming a (Zariski) topology on Some results about their structures including a version of Nullstellensatz of congruences are obtained.
